How they compare

United States Virgin Islands currently reports 3.45 million constant 2015 US$ per square kilometre against 2.72 million constant 2015 US$ per square kilometre in Qatar, a difference of 729,530 constant 2015 US$ per square kilometre.

That makes United States Virgin Islands's figure about 1.3 times Qatar's.

Across all 19 years both countries report, United States Virgin Islands has been ahead every year.

Qatar ranks 15th and United States Virgin Islands ranks 12th of 166 countries.

United States Virgin Islands has averaged higher in every one of the 3 decades both report.
